Couple of months ago, I have posted about a problem which I was having with Gmail and yet I’m about to post a new one.
I’m sure everyone has noticed that progress bar after you enter your account information in login form. I don’t know how long it has been since gmail put that loading bar. This is one of the problems I’m having with Gmail in Firefox.
Here is the screen shot. It stops at that very end of the bar and it doesn’t go trough. At first, I waited bit more for it to load but didn’t go through. I tried clearing cookies, browsing history and other private data but it didn’t work. Only thing that works is that you have to hit “refresh” button. Either it stops at the end like that screenshot or it never starts loading.
I’m going to try to reinstall Firefox 3 if this keeps being a problem. I’ll also update this post if anything works. Gmail works fine with other browsers. I don’t get this problem in Safari, Opera, IE7.

Not sure if this will work for everyone but it did for me. I was having the same problem (logging into gmail with firefox on a PC). This is from the Google help centre:
In Firefox for PCs: (https://mail.google.com/support/bin/static.py?page=troubleshooter.cs&problem=bugflow&selected=bugflow_signin00_signin14_signin15#step2_a)
1. Log out of your Google Mail account and close all other open browser windows.
2. Click the Tools menu at the top of your browser and select Clear Private Data…
3. Select the Cookies and Cache checkboxes.
4. Click Clear Private Data Now.

I had the same problem with gmail and facebook : uninstall the skype add-on and it should work
